Funnily enough, when Cale was on Desert Island Discs he nominated Alexandra Leaving, suggesting that Hallelujah isn't even his favourite Cohen song.

Or maybe like a lot of other people he's just sick of it .

And Alexandra Leaving is maybe Cohen's best song of 'recent' years'

Went to MSG to see Cohen in December and same thing happened - Sharon Robertson sang Alexandra Leaving alone. Got one of the biggest ovations of the night.

Always been somethign he's liked - having women sing his songs. Judy Collins, Jennifer Warnes, Sharon Robertson. I know what you mean about paying to see LC, but if he feels that is the best arrangment for that song, so be it.
